I use my horse shavings bought in bale type bags. Newspaper on the bottom then the shavings and then lots of hay. Never had a problem with this :)
 
you could try to get extra newspaper from somewhere to keep you going - I get mine from my vets (they get given it, but don't need it)... then you'd need a thinner layer of litter :)
 
Wooden pelleted cat litter. I find a bag lasts longer than mezazorb. A layer in the bottom, lots of hay. The pellets soak up the liquid and then turn to powder, so I only clean the litter trays twice a week.

I just use newspaper and hay. The rabbits are too busy munching the hay to bother eating the paper.
 
bio catolet..ive tried everything else and this is great and can even be bought in small bags via tesco grocery orders online!

we get bigger ones from pet planet or k9 capers online.

i use russell rabbit bedding straw as a top layer with some hay to nibble..stays working for ages..with frenchies that 24hrs!:lol: no pongs either like with wood pellets and doesnt get everywhere like megazorb.
